Liferay 6.1 portlet 在 5.2.3 中工作不正确

标签 liferay portlet

我有一个在 Liferay 6.1 门户上运行良好的 portlet,但是当我在 Liferay 5.2.3 上部署它时 我的配置页面甚至没有打开。 我应该如何让它发挥作用?

最佳答案

这是一个不错的权威answer一个非常相似的问题。

较新版本的 portlet 不适用于较旧的 Liferay 安装。因为它们是使用最新的 plugins-sdk 编译的,而且还有自上一个版本以来发生变化的不同 jar。

因此,如果您希望较新版本的 portlet 与任何旧版本一起工作,那么您必须使用带有该插件-SDK 的旧版本 Liferay 来编译 portlet。我确信 Liferay 6.1 portlet 中会有很多类和 jsp 标签,它们在 Liferay 5.2.3 中不起作用。

关于Liferay 6.1 portlet 在 5.2.3 中工作不正确,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13927914/

相关文章:

java - 如何在 Liferay 中正确获取 portlet 首选项?

elasticsearch - Liferay Elasticsearch 查询 : Search for DLFileEntries that have a Custom Document Type

java - Liferay 使用 PostgreSQL?

java - Liferay : how can i upload a image from portlet preferences?

forms - 在 Liferay 中使用 Orbeon Forms

java - Maven添加依赖时复制JAR

java - 公司范围的首选项设置在 Liferay 中不起作用

java - Portlet 规范 - 处理异步 Multipart 请求

Liferay - 每个页面的布局

html - Liferay 避免从/html/文件夹加载文件